Designed by personal defense trainer Michael Janich, the Spyderco Yojimbo 2 is a tactical folder with superior ergonomics. Featuring a wide, tapered wharncliffe blade that’s highly contoured for a strong grip, the Yojimbo 2 ensures maximum surface contact for positive control Read More
